欧洲变态另类zozo,欧美xxxx做受欧美gaybdsm,欧洲熟妇色xxxx欧美老妇软件,免费人成视频xvideos入口 ,欧美.日韩.国产.中文字幕

歡迎光臨
我們一直在努力

聚合函數(shù)求數(shù)據(jù)總和是哪個(gè)函數(shù)

在數(shù)據(jù)庫(kù)操作中,求數(shù)據(jù)總和的聚合函數(shù)是sum()。

這看似簡(jiǎn)單的一個(gè)問(wèn)題,實(shí)際操作中卻可能遇到不少坑。我曾經(jīng)在項(xiàng)目中就因?yàn)閷?duì)SUM()函數(shù)的理解不夠深入,導(dǎo)致了不小的麻煩。當(dāng)時(shí)需要統(tǒng)計(jì)某個(gè)表中所有訂單的總金額。我直接使用了SELECT SUM(order_amount) FROM orders; 這條語(yǔ)句,本以為萬(wàn)事大吉。結(jié)果卻發(fā)現(xiàn),統(tǒng)計(jì)結(jié)果遠(yuǎn)小于預(yù)期。

經(jīng)過(guò)仔細(xì)排查,我發(fā)現(xiàn)問(wèn)題出在order_amount字段中存在一些無(wú)效數(shù)據(jù),例如負(fù)數(shù)或者空值。SUM()函數(shù)會(huì)將這些無(wú)效數(shù)據(jù)納入計(jì)算,導(dǎo)致最終結(jié)果錯(cuò)誤。解決方法是,在SUM()函數(shù)之前添加一個(gè)WHERE子句,過(guò)濾掉這些無(wú)效數(shù)據(jù)。 最終的SQL語(yǔ)句變成了SELECT SUM(order_amount) FROM orders WHERE order_amount > 0;,這才得到了正確的總金額。

另一個(gè)需要注意的點(diǎn)是數(shù)據(jù)類型。如果你的字段不是數(shù)值類型,例如是文本類型,直接使用SUM()函數(shù)將會(huì)報(bào)錯(cuò)。你需要在使用SUM()函數(shù)之前,確保你的字段是數(shù)值類型,或者使用相應(yīng)的類型轉(zhuǎn)換函數(shù)將其轉(zhuǎn)換為數(shù)值類型。 例如,如果order_amount字段是文本類型,可以嘗試SELECT SUM(CAST(order_amount AS DECIMAL(10,2))) FROM orders; (假設(shè)order_amount存儲(chǔ)的是兩位小數(shù)的金額)。 這個(gè)轉(zhuǎn)換函數(shù)的具體寫法取決于你的數(shù)據(jù)庫(kù)系統(tǒng)。

再舉個(gè)例子,假設(shè)你需要統(tǒng)計(jì)不同地區(qū)訂單的總金額。這時(shí)候,就需要結(jié)合GROUP BY子句使用SUM()函數(shù)。例如:SELECT region, SUM(order_amount) AS total_amount FROM orders GROUP BY region; 這條語(yǔ)句會(huì)根據(jù)地區(qū)分組,并計(jì)算每個(gè)地區(qū)的訂單總金額。 如果你的地區(qū)字段存在空值,那么GROUP BY子句會(huì)將所有空值歸為一組,這可能不是你想要的結(jié)果。 因此,處理空值也是一個(gè)需要考慮的細(xì)節(jié)。

總之,看似簡(jiǎn)單的SUM()函數(shù),在實(shí)際應(yīng)用中需要仔細(xì)考慮數(shù)據(jù)完整性、數(shù)據(jù)類型以及分組等因素,才能確保得到準(zhǔn)確的結(jié)果。 理解這些細(xì)節(jié),才能避免在數(shù)據(jù)統(tǒng)計(jì)工作中出現(xiàn)不必要的錯(cuò)誤。 記住,細(xì)致的檢查和對(duì)潛在問(wèn)題的預(yù)判,是高效完成數(shù)據(jù)處理的關(guān)鍵。

路由網(wǎng)(www.lu-you.com)您可以查閱其它相關(guān)文章!

贊(0) 打賞
未經(jīng)允許不得轉(zhuǎn)載:路由網(wǎng) » 聚合函數(shù)求數(shù)據(jù)總和是哪個(gè)函數(shù)

更好的WordPress主題

支持快訊、專題、百度收錄推送、人機(jī)驗(yàn)證、多級(jí)分類篩選器,適用于垂直站點(diǎn)、科技博客、個(gè)人站,扁平化設(shè)計(jì)、簡(jiǎn)潔白色、超多功能配置、會(huì)員中心、直達(dá)鏈接、文章圖片彈窗、自動(dòng)縮略圖等...

聯(lián)系我們聯(lián)系我們

覺(jué)得文章有用就打賞一下文章作者

非常感謝你的打賞,我們將繼續(xù)提供更多優(yōu)質(zhì)內(nèi)容,讓我們一起創(chuàng)建更加美好的網(wǎng)絡(luò)世界!

支付寶掃一掃

微信掃一掃

登錄

找回密碼

注冊(cè)